Hi This also goes to the OpenMath 3 Mailinglist since this concerns the nontation definitions at http://svn.openmath.org/OpenMath/OpenMath3/cd/MathML/
Let me summarise: The notation definitions lack precedence attributes on many rendering elements. This means that JOMDoc does not drop fences which are not required according to the operator precedence. If you render the following Content MathML formula, then all fences are included! <math xmlns="http://www.w3.org/1998/Math/MathML" display="block"> <apply><csymbol cd="arith1">plus</csymbol> <apply><csymbol cd="arith1">times</csymbol> <ci>a</ci> <ci>x</ci> </apply> <ci>b</ci> </apply> </math> According to Michael, the notation definition I took from arith1.ntn are at fault. They have hove no precedence attributes on the rendering elements: Michael Kohlhase wrote: > I think that the rendering you are using below does not declare the > operator precedence. > It should be something like > > <rendering precedence="500"> > ^^^^^^^^^^^^^^^^ > <m:mrow> > <m:mo mcd:egroup="fence" fence="true">(</m:mo> > <iterate name="args" precedence="500"> > <separator><m:mo mcd:cr="fun">+</m:mo></separator> > <render name="arg"/> > </iterate> > <m:mo mcd:egroup="fence" fence="true">)</m:mo> > </m:mrow> > </rendering> > > > Please try this. Indeed, setting precedence attributes on the rendering elements causes JOMDoc to drop the unnecessary fences. > I am not sure how the rendering elements without precedence > attributes got into arith1.omdoc, but it was probably a bug in my > conversion stylesheet. Actually they are part of the notation definitions from http://svn.openmath.org/OpenMath/OpenMath3/cd/MathML/ and therefore also of the notation definitions bundled with JOMDoc. Note that this problem is not only in arith1.ntn but also in others, for example logic1.ntn and relation1.ntn. Unfortunately, I have no clue what would be the right precedence values, so I can not provide a patch.
